/*  ---------  CSS generated for skn5_guppy2015  ----------- */

html { /* Taille équivalente à 10px - Ne pas modifier */
	font-size: 62.5%;
    background: url(img/cfs.png);
}
body { /* Taille équivalente à 14px - Modifier en fonction de la taille choisie */
	font-size: 1.4rem; /* par exemple 1.6rem pour 16px */
}
#TopBoxes .tbl, #TopBoxes .tblover {
    background: transparent; /* modification pour l'affichage boites dans TopBoxes */
}
#BlogCenterBoxes {
    margin: 2px 0 0; /* modification marge externe en haut boite centrale blog */
}
#footer {
	padding-top: 15px; /* modification du padding pour le haut */
    color: #C0C0C0; /* modification de la couleur */	
}
.txtspeG {
    padding: 8px 0;	
}
.copyright, .timer {
    font-size: .8em; /* modification de la taille de l'affichage */
    color: #C0C0C0; /* modification de la couleur */	
}
.top {
    color: #C0C0C0; /* modification de la couleur */
    font-size: 1.5em; /* modification de la taille de l'affichage */
}
div.logo { /* block logo */
    padding: 20px 8px 8px; /* modification du padding pour le haut */
}	
div.banner { /* block bannière */
    padding: 80px 20px 10px; /* position bannière en fonction de la hauteur du logo */
}	
div.quote { /* block citation */
    margin: 20px 5px 5px; /* modification marges externes */
	padding: 30px; /* modification marges internes */
    background: url(img/citation.png) no-repeat 50% 100%; /* position de l'image de fond */
	min-height: 130px; /* hauteur minimum pour l'affichage */
}
div.menuIcons ul li {
  margin-left: 0;
  margin-right: 0;
}
div.pop.menuIcons_flag {
	top: 32px; /* ajustement positionnement du drapeau */
}
div.menuIcons ul li.menu_connect { /* positionnement de l'onglet en haut à droite */
    position: absolute; top: 2px; right: 100px;
    padding-right: 3px;
}
div.menuIcons ul li.menu_connect a span { /* lien Connexion */
    color: #C0C0C0; /* couleur texte lien connexion */
    border: 0; /* bordure à droite */
    box-shadow: none;
}
div.menuIcons ul li.menu_admin { /* positionnement de l'onglet en haut à droite */
    position: absolute; top: 2px; right: 2px;
    padding-right: 3px;
}
div.menuIcons ul li.menu_admin a span { /* lien Admin */
    color: #C0C0C0; /* couleur texte lien admin */
    border: 0; /* bordure à droite */
    box-shadow: none;
}
div.menuIcons ul li a span { /* lien */
    padding: 0 10px; /* espacement des items */
    font: small-caps 16px Verdana, "Bitstream Vera Sans", sans-serif; /* Menu en petites majuscules */
    line-height: 30px;
    border-right: 1px solid #FFF; /* bordure à droite */
    box-shadow: 1px 0px 0px #C0C0C0; /* ombre */
}
div.menuIcons ul li a span.current { /* lien actif */
    color: #FFF; /* couleur texte lien actif */
    background-color: #EF9911; /* couleur de fond de l'onglet actif */
    padding: 0 10px;  /* espacement des items */
    border: 1px inset #FFF; /* bordure de l'onglet actif */
    text-decoration: none; /* pas de soulignement underline */
}
div.menuIcons ul li a:hover span { /* lien survolé*/
    color: #404040; /* couleur texte lien survolé */
    background-color: #ADE02E; /* couleur de fond de l'onglet survolé */
    padding: 0 10px;  /* espacement des items */
    border: 1px outset #FFF; /* bordure de l'onglet survolé */
    text-decoration: none; /* pas de soulignement underline */	
    position: relative;top:0;left:0; /* pas de décalage liens */
}
.titrebox { /* Titre boite latérale */
    font: small-caps 20px Verdana, "Bitstream Vera Sans", sans-serif;
	letter-spacing: 0.1em; /* ajout pour augmenter l'espacement des lettres */
}
.tblbox {  /* Corps boite latérale */
    margin-bottom: 15px; /* marge bas de boite */
}
.titre { /* Titre boite centrale */ 
	letter-spacing: 0.1em; /* ajout pour augmenter l'espacement des lettres */
}
.rubr, p.rubr, .lirubr, .lirubr2, .phrubr, .phrubr2, .farubr, .farubr2, .dnrubr, .dnrubr2  {
    margin: 1em auto;  /* Ajout marges au dessus et au dessous pour rubriques */
	font-weight: bold; /* modification pour style texte en gras */
    color: #0C8ED4; /* modification couleur pour les rubriques */
}
.curr_item, ul.item li.curr_item, ul.item li.curr_item a, ul.item li.curr_item a:hover { /* titre article est affiché */
    font-weight: bold;/* modification pour style texte en gras */
    color: #0C8ED4; /* modification couleur pour le titre article affiché */
    background: transparent; /* modification de la coumeur de fond */
}
.item {
    font-weight: bold;/* modification pour style texte en gras */
    color: #0C8ED4; /* modification couleur pour le titre */
    background: transparent; /* modification de la coumeur de fond */	
}
.phimg { /* position, encadrement, ombre pour les miniatures des galeries photos */
    margin: 4px 4px 10px;
	border: 1px solid #C0C0C0 !important;
	border-radius: 4px;
    box-shadow: 1px 2px 2px #C0C0C0;	
}
fieldset.dwnld {
    background-color: #FFF; /* modification de la couleur du fond de la popup de téléchargement */
}
.cal {
    border: 0px solid #FFF; /* pour supprimer encadrement agenda */
}
tr.cal { /* calendar nav bar */
    color: #FFF;
    background-color: #00BEF2;
}
td.cals { /* week */
    color: #FFF;
    background-color: #00BEF2;
}
.calagd { /* lien vers agenda du mois */
    color: #FFF; /* modification de la couleur du texte */
}
a:hover.calagd {
    color: #404040;	/* modification de la couleur du texte du lien */
}			  
select.cal { /* select month and year */
    color: #000; /* modification pour les champs mois et année du calendrier */
    background-color: #FFF;
    border: 1px solid #C0C0C0;
}
.selYearCal { /* largeur champ année */
	width: 72px;
}
div #toolbarIcons_ptxt, div #toolbarSmileys_ptxt {
    border: 1px solid #000; /* ajout d'une bordure */
}
.forum, .forum a, .forum2, tr.forum2, tr.forum2 a, tr.forum2 a:hover  {
    font: bold 16px Verdana, "Bitstream Vera Sans", sans-serif; /* modification pour texte en gras et taille */
    color: #FFF; /* modification couleur du texte */
}
.thtbldiv {
    font-weight:bold; /* modification pour texte en gras */
    padding: 4px; /* ajout padding */
}
.visits { 
    background-color: #EEE; /* personnalisation background popup */
}	
.SWPHL0 { /* habillage boite photorama */
    margin-top: 10px;
	color: inherit;
    background: transparent;
    border: 1px solid #C0C0C0;
	padding: 5px;
    border-radius: 8px;		
    box-shadow: 1px 4px 4px #C0C0C0;
}
.FB394 { /* habillage boîte slider camera */
    margin: -5px 3px 30px;
    padding-bottom: 60px;
    background-color: transparent;
}
#EditoBoxes .tbl.FB444 { /* boite edito */
    color: inherit;
    background: transparent;
}
.DDV421 { /* ajustement menu vertical */
    margin: 2px 0 7px 1px;
    width: 100%;
    background-color: transparent;	
}
ul.dropdown li, ul.dropdown ul li {
	margin:0 auto 1px;  /* modification marges extérieures */
    font-variant: small-caps; /* ajout pour petites majuscules */
}
.tbl.DDH460, .tblover.DDH460 { /* fond menu déroulant horizontal */
    background: transparent;
}	
.tbl.DDL461, .tblover.DDL461 { /* fond menu déroulant linéaire */
    background: transparent;
}
.DDL461 ul.dropdown-linear li { /* personnalisation onglets DDL */
    width: 12em;
    font: bold 16px Verdana, "Bitstream Vera Sans", sans-serif;
	letter-spacing: 0.1em;	
    background-color: transparent;
    text-align: center;	
}
.DDL461 ul.dropdown-linear li:hover { /* personnalisation onglets DDL over */
	color: #FFF;
    background-color: #60C4EA;	
}
.DDL461 ul.dropdown-linear li ul li { /* personnalisation menu DDL */
    font-weight: normal;
    width: 560%;
    height: 100%;
	color: #404040;
    background-color: #FFF;
    border: 4px solid #404040;	
    border-radius: 0px 0px 10px 10px;
}
.DDL461 ul.dropdown-linear li:hover ul li { /* personnalisation menu DDL over */
	background-color: #FFF;
    border: 4px solid #404040;
    border-radius: 0px 0px 10px 10px;	
}
.titrebox.TrUSRB0 { /* positionnement boite Préférences à BottomBoxes */
    margin-left: 5px;
    padding: 7px 0;
	background-color: #D786FE;
	text-align: center;
	border-radius: 4px 4px 0 0;
}
.tblbox.USRB0 {  /* Corps boite Préférences et positionnement à BottomBoxes */ 
	margin: 0px 6px 50px;	
    color: inherit;
    background-color: #F2F2F2;
    box-shadow: 1px 1px 0px #CBC7B8;
}	
.titrebox.TrWEBB0 { /* positionnement boite Webmestre-Infos à BottomBoxes */
    margin: 0 10px 0;
    padding: 7px 0;
	background-color: #77BE32;
	text-align: center;
	border-radius: 4px 4px 0 0;	
}
.tblbox.WEBB0 {  /* Corps boite Webmestre-Infos et positionnement à BottomBoxes */
    margin: 0 11px 50px;
    color: inherit;
    background-color: #F2F2F2;
    box-shadow: 1px 1px 0px #CBC7B8;
}
.titrebox.TrNWLB0 {/* positionnement boite Newletter à BottomBoxes */
    margin-right: 5px;
    padding: 7px 0;
	background-color: #E0548C;
	text-align: center;
	border-radius: 4px 4px 0 0;
}
.tblbox.NWLB0 {  /* Corps boite Newsletter et positionnement à BottomBoxes */
    margin: 0 6px 50px;
    color: inherit;
    background-color: #F2F2F2;
    box-shadow: 1px 1px 0px #CBC7B8;
}
#gyaccordion li a {
    padding: 10px 4px; /* modification marges intérieures */
}
#gyaccordion li a.closed, #gyaccordion li.firstitem a.closed, #gyaccordion li.lastitem a.closed {
    margin: 6px 0;
    color: #FFFFFF !important;
    background-color: #404040;	/* ajustement marges externes et couleurs */
}
#gyaccordion li li {
    margin: 10px auto;
    line-height: 20px;
    border: 1px solid #FFF; /* ajustement marges externes et couleurs */
}			     
    